See the frequency is proportional to the square root of (k/m) which implies that the frequency is inversely proportional to m. So as we wax the tuning fork, the mass increase as a result the frequency will decrease.

JEE main math's is straightforward, but it necessitates a great deal of speed, which necessitates practice. In recent years, the paper has also grown in length. Each chapter's NCERT miscellaneous problems should be completed.
Also, practice a lot, there are books available in the market that cover the last 10 or more years of JEE main paper. Do it to get a sense of the questions on the paper. They mostly prepare for advanced because the majority of people who appear in mains also give advanced.
However, there are a few chapters in the mains that are not advanced, such as Set Theory, Statistics, and Mathematical Reasoning, that students ignore, but these chapters frequently come up in questions. So make sure you complete them correctly and remain confident that the questions will not be difficult.

B.Arch: B.Arch is a course that involves the study of human psychology, physical and chemical qualities of various materials, and the study of architecture and its form. A creative mind and the ability to envision things are required. Bachelor of Architecture is concerned with structures or spaces that have been thoughtfully planned by a designer or architect and are the most pleasant for anybody to utilise. Bachelor of architecture (B.Arch) is the study of several areas of architecture using various disciplines such as Humanities, Environmental Studies, Mathematics, Engineering, and Aesthetics.
Bachelor of Architecture (B.Arch.) is a five-year undergraduate curriculum that requires a minimum of 50% in Class 12 to be pursued. The B.Arch programme is meant to create licenced and professional architects who are qualified to work on both private and public projects. The action of designing models of buildings, preparing blueprints, and other physical structures of any site and building is included in architectural studies.The commercial and construction industries are experiencing increased demand. As a result, after completing this course, experts and professionals will be able to meet this need.

B.Pharma: The Bachelor of Pharmacy (B. Pharma.) is a bachelor's academic degree in the area of pharmacy. B. Pharmacy is the study of a variety of topics related to pharmaceutical science, including drug safety, discovery, medicinal chemistry, industrial pharmacy, and a variety of other topics. This degree is appropriate for students who wish to become pharmacists and want to understand how various pharmaceutical medications influence the human body.
B. Pharma. is a bachelor's degree programme in pharmacy that teaches students the fundamentals of the profession. To get a better knowledge of the subject, students are taught human anatomy, pharmaceutical analysis, human anatomy and physiology, pharmaceutical engineering, pharmacology, industrial pharmacy, and a variety of other areas.
